Understanding Different Types of Dryers

Before diving into the specifics of dryer selection, it’s essential to understand the different types available in the market. The most common types are vented, condenser, and heat pump dryers. Vented dryers expel hot air outside, which can be beneficial for quick drying but may require proper installation. On the other hand, condenser dryers collect moisture in a tank, making them versatile but potentially slower. Heat pump dryers use a more energy-efficient method by recycling hot air.
When considering which type of dryer to purchase, think about your home’s layout and the available space. For instance, if you live in an apartment or a compact area, a condenser dryer might be more suitable as it doesn’t require venting. Additionally, consider your drying needs—families with children might benefit from a vented dryer for quicker cycles.
Key Features to Look For
When choosing a dryer, several features can enhance your drying experience. Look for options such as moisture sensors, which can prevent over-drying and save energy. Additionally, multiple drying programs tailored to different fabric types are essential for maintaining the quality of your clothes.
Energy efficiency is another critical factor. Many modern dryers come with an energy rating, which can help you gauge their operational costs. Investing in a dryer with a high energy rating may have a higher upfront cost but can save you money in the long run. As you consider your options, remember that the initial purchase price is just one part of the total cost of ownership.
Maintenance Tips for Longevity
Once you’ve selected the right dryer, proper maintenance is crucial for its longevity. Regularly cleaning the lint filter after each use is essential to ensure efficient airflow and prevent potential fire hazards. Additionally, consider scheduling a professional cleaning of the venting system at least once a year to avoid clogs that can affect performance.
For those who may encounter issues, knowing when to seek professional help is vital. If you notice unusual noises or a significant drop in drying performance, it might be time to contact a technician. Cost Considerations
When budgeting for a dryer, consider not only the purchase price but also installation and ongoing operating costs. Prices can vary significantly based on the type and features, ranging from a few hundred to over a thousand dollars. It’s wise to compare models and read reviews to ensure you’re getting the best value for your money.
Additionally, factor in the cost of energy consumption based on the dryer’s efficiency. Some models may offer smart features that allow you to monitor usage, which can help in managing your energy bills effectively. By doing thorough research, you can find a dryer that meets your needs without breaking the bank.
